The Nintendo Switch version of Go Vacation (2018) is a port of the 2011 Wii classic, featuring several exclusive enhancements not found in the original release. While the game's core "Kawawii Island" experience remains intact, the Switch version introduces specific mechanical and content updates designed for the modern console. Switch-Exclusive Gameplay Features Fishing Minigame:
A completely new activity added for the Switch version, allowing players to fish at over 30 spots across the Marine and Mountain resorts. Animal Photography:
Players can now find and photograph over 40 types of animals throughout the island, collecting them in an in-game photo book. Daily Challenges and Gifts:
A set of three daily challenges appears across the island. Completing these, or receiving air-dropped reward boxes from planes, provides XP and unlocks new dog breeds, costumes, and villa items. XP Progression System:
The progression system was overhauled; instead of unlocking Villa items via Silver Keys from activities, players now earn XP by playing games, doing tricks, and completing world challenges to level up and gain rewards. Food Trucks:

Comparative Analysis: Go Vacation Nintendo Switch vs. Original Wii Originally released in 2011 for the Nintendo Wii Go to product viewer dialog for this item. Go Vacation was ported to the Nintendo Switch Go to product viewer dialog for this item.
in 2018 as a remastered, portable holiday simulator. While it retains the core open-world exploration of Kawawii Island, the Switch version introduces several exclusive features, gameplay mechanics, and technical updates while removing a small number of original activities. Switch-Exclusive Additions and Changes
The Switch version introduced new content to encourage daily play and deeper exploration of its four main resorts (Marine, City, Snow, and Mountain). Go Vacation - Nintendo Switch - Review
